SAN DIEGO, CA -- (MARKET WIRE) -- 02/07/2006 -- Cell Bio-Systems, Inc. (OTC: CBSI) a developer of medical devices and patented technologies for the plastic, cosmetic, orthopedic, and living tissue markets, today announced it has ramped up production of its Johnnie Lok accessory, another tool in its series of accessories for disposable cannulas. Co-branded by Cell Bio-Systems with Tulip Medical Instrumentation, the Johnnie Lok is the key to the Tulip Syringe System. Used in combination with a full system of cannulas and other accessories, the Johnnie Lok is used to lock and hold the plunger of the syringe under vacuum and provides volume control for precision extraction (60cc, 35cc and 10cc). This marks the first time the Johnnie Lok is being used in a disposable instrument. According to Darin Andersen, president of CBSI, the production of the accessory has moved ahead of schedule to be ready in time for packaging with the company's disposable cannulas when they receive FDA clearance.
